BOYAA (Barrio Obrero Youth Athletic Association) is the oldest existing youth organization in Manila which count among its members notable personnel in all fields of endeavor (arts, education, politics, etc.). This is the basketball court that has seen the likes of Tantay, Sagar Barria, Romy Diaz, PBA Star Players Atoy Co, Jun Padilla, Butch Bautista, Caloy Loyzaga, Chat Gallardo, Hermie Isidro, Mayor Mel Lopez, Herminio Astorga, Manny Jocson, Alcantara/Serzo brothers, etc. This was the pre-MICAA days when Yellow Taxi Cab (pre-YCO), Yu-Chu (the precursor of Yutivo) and Ysmael Steel used to play against each other in different fiesta leagues in City of Manila most notably, Obrero (Zone 17), Trozo (Zone 24-Tondo 2), Tanduay (Quiapo), Loreto, Solis (Santa Cruz), Moriones (Tondo 1), Paco (Plaza Hugo), L. Lupa, Almeda and Tecson.
